Look no further than GC Surplus, the site where the Government of Canada auctions off seized and surplus items in its possession to the general public. As you can imagine, it gets wacky. But there are some gems to be found. Listed below are 15 items, ranging from cars to holiday decorations, currently up for auction in Quebec. Note that prices listed are minimum bids as of the time of writing. These items will also disappear from the site once the bidding period has ended. To place a bid, you first have to register on the site. Good luck!
